Public Sector Solutions Group

The Public Sector Solutions Group is an award-winning Information Technology consulting firm with an emphasis on access to real-time information and an enhanced user experience. It is our mission to enable critical business processes for clients, by facilitating collaboration, data analytics, and informed stakeholder decisions. PS2G embraces the principles of Human Centric Solution Design. Working with small and large clients, we prioritize the user experience as a critical success factor. Our clients are prepared for market dynamics and evolving constituent requirements global solutions as a method of breaking institutional silos; and preparing our clients for market dynamics and evolving constituent requirements. We focus on delivering value in the following three vertical markets: Energy and Utility PS2G assists E&U partners in improving their infrastructure by managing data consolidations and workflow reengineering. Our work in remote monitoring provides real time updates for clients to understand their service status, and for engineers to conduct preventative maintenance. HealthCare Our mission in HealthCare is to leverage technology to lower the cost of plan administration. We provide services that simplify and automate member outreach while maintaining a personal touch. We continue to innovate in the area of member services to ensure regulatory compliance, and our consulting team focuses on building strategic plans around SDOH, and operational concerns. Public Sector In the Public Sector vertical, PS2G provides a full suite of digital transformation services in support of public records. Our services span the full record life cycle, from creation to disposition, and include conversion, digital workflow automations, and records management.
